Reveals whomst thou art with a single character.

omst
prints one of five characters based upon your effective user permissions:
#
for absolute permissions (i.e. root
, administrator)@
for system users$
for ordinary users%
for restricted users (e.g. nobody
, guest)?
if any error occursIn all cases, the character is followed by a newline. If an error occurs, it may be printed to
stderr
; be sure to suppress this error if you plan to use the character in a prompt.
Currently, unix-family systems (including Linux, Mac OS, and most BSDs) and Windows are supported. Android and iOS support is currently not available.
